The 2005 French Open Tennis Tournament

Introduction

French Open in 1891 was only a national tournament. However, after 1925 it became open to international competitors. It is the second Grand Slam event that is held in a year after the Australian Championships. It is held over two weeks between mid May and early June in Paris which is situated in France. This tournament is named after a pilot who was a hero in the World War I. It is the only Grand Slam Tournament that features clay courts for holding the events. Due to this the participants find it quite difficult to play in these courts.

 

It is because these courts tend to slow down the ball pace and also add extra bounce to the ball. The 2005 French Open Tennis Tournament was one such event that was held in the red clay court of Philippe Chatrier.

The 2005 French Open Tennis Tournament Statistics

The 2005 French Open Tennis Tournament featured the events of Mens Singles, Womens Singles, Mens Doubles, Womens Doubles, Mixed Doubles and Junior Championships. In the Mens Singles Rafael Nadal defeated Mariano Puerta by 6-7, 6-3, 6-1, 7-5. In the Womens Singles Justine Henin defeated Mary Pierce by straight sets 6-1, 6-1. In the Mens Doubles Jonas Bjorkman and Max Mirnyi won the title by defeating Bob Bryan and Mike Bryan by 2-6, 6-1, 6-4. In the Womens Doubles Virginia Ruano Pascual and Paola Suarez defeated Cara Black and Liezel Huber by 4-6, 6-3, 6-3. In the Mixed Doubles the event was won by Daniela Hantuchova and Fabrice Santoro after they defeated Martina Navratilova and Leander Paes by 3-6, 6-3, 6-3. In the Junior Championships the Boys Singles was won by Marin Cilic. The Girls Singles was won by Agnez Szavay. The Boys Doubles was won by Emiliano Massa and Leonardo Mayer and the Girls Doubles was won by Victoria Azarenka and Agnez Szavay.
